Founded in 2017, Wayve is the leading developer of Embodied AI technology.  Our advanced AI software and foundation models enable vehicles to perceive, understand, and navigate any complex environment, enhancing the usability and safety of automated driving systems.

Our vision is to create autonomy that propels the world forward.  Our intelligent, mapless, and hardware-agnostic AI products are designed for automakers, accelerating the transition from assisted to automated driving.

As Communications Lead for the UK and Europe, you will own Wayve’s PR strategy and execution across several key functions, including corporate, policy, and product comms. 

The UK is Wayve’s home market, and London is the first city we’ll launch the Wayve AI Driver in.You will be responsible for sustaining and growing Wayve’s reputation as a leading technology company there and across Europe, while also shaping the communications strategy for core product and technology milestones across our automotive and robotaxi businesses, alongside partners such as Nissan, Stellantis, and Uber. 

 

This is a high-ownership role for someone who is comfortable operating as a player-coach and who is motivated by strategic impact, autonomy, and breadth. You will work closely with Marketing, Policy, Product, Partnerships, and Executive Leadership to shape external narratives, manage market activity and build trusted relationships with media and other stakeholders.

 

This is a rare opportunity to shape the communications strategy for one of the most visible and strategically important markets in autonomous driving, working at the intersection of AI, public policy, and commercialization.
